OTAGO LAND BOARD

The meeting of the Land Board continned on Wedneeday, 12th, was attended by the Commissioner of Crown Lands (Mr D. Bar,ron), and Messrs "W. Dallas, J. Tough, and J. M. M'Kenzie. The following applications were dealt with : — Andrew Donaldson applied for a license to out posts. Tramway Creek, Crookston District.— Granted for one year at a rojaltv of £7 10s.

Joseph JRrateir asked. the board to reconsider the application by J. G. Colo to transfer corporation lease 17x, seotion 111, block IX. Maruwhenua district, to him. — Held over.

Ranger O'Neill reported on the position of yearly license held by Wm. Thos. Ridd over area near the Minzion Burn, block 111, Benger district. — As Mr Ridd has left the district, it was decided not to renew the license.

Percy E. Lambert applied for a license to occupy the unsold sections in Block I, 11, and II!, town of Waitaki Bridge.— Declined.

John Thomson, on behalf of John Buchanan applied for a license to cut and remove flax over an area of 100 acres on Run No. 179, Crookston district. — Declined.

R. M'Qiiade wrote with reference to damage done to sections 17 and 101. block IX, Manuwhftnua district, by the recent floods. — Board unable to ussist »n the matter.

The Secretary. Education Board, wror.e asking* that 6O.ction 16a, Obekaike Settlement, education reserve, be vested in the Education Board. — License held by Mra Fraser oaneelled, as section ie now required for school purposes : part of rent; to bs refunded; Minister to be recommended to ve3t the section in the Education Board.

The Secretary, Education Board, wrote asking" that section 45, Stewa-rd Settlement. be vested in the Education Board. — Minister recommended to vest section in Education Board as desired.

Ranger O'Neill reported on the application by J. and J. Edg-ar for a. license to cut 1000 broa-dleaf fencir-g poets on the south boun-d&ry of B-un No. 104 a, Glen-kf-nioh. — License granted subj'sct to J\les3r3 Edgar arrangin.tr with pastoral lessee ; royalty 8s por 100. Six Awapoko &ettlor6, Stswar'd Settlement, petitioned asking th^t th? Awaxnoko Stiver 06 diverted to its original channel. — «3oTOrijmerrt recommended to give effect to puoltion and vote a sum for the work. linger D^Jft^ll reported on a small area in Blook 111, Betse-r district, between the river and sections 57 and jb«l S3, fenced in

by Roderick M'Donald. — Yearly license granted, rent 10s.

After consideration of an application by James Henry Buchanan to purchase an area of about three acres of the reserve on the bank of ihe river, block VIII, Tuapeka West district, the warden and ranger having forwarded reports, it was granted, subject to the usual chain reserve being lefc along the river.

James M'Cone wrote w ith reference to the condition of the sludge channel through his section 27, Tokorahi Estate. — Board unable to render any further assistance.

Ranger Atkinson reported on the improvements effected by G. R. Cross on section 24a, Greenfield Settlement. — Report received.

An application for land under Lands for Settlement Act by W. J. Cross for section 19. Block XII, Teaneraki Settlement, was granted. Application for land on renewable lease, Jessie Robinson, section 7, 8, 13, 14, 16, 20a, 23, block 111, Maungatua district.— Granted.

Application to transfer, from Alex. C Goodlet to Thomas Bates, jun.. section 26, block VII, Woodland district. — Granted.

Application to transfer for yearly license, from A. W. Foster to David Hall, mining reserve in block "V, Table Hill district. — Granted.

Application to transfer interest in email grazing run, from H. M. Smith to J. M. Smith, Run 224 a, 227, Blackstone.—Declined, as permanent residence required has not been completed. Application to transfer, from J. R. Kirk (as executor of the late Duncan M'Lennan) to Robert Duncan, section 22, block XIII, Moeraki district.— Granted.

Application for O.R.P. license. Alfred T. N. Stevenson, section 16, block XV, Crcokston district. — Granted ; yearly license held by J. Beighton cancelled. 'Application to transfer pastoral run, from executors of the late Jane Hay to Wm. Hay, section 7, block 3, Catlins district.— Granted.
